ترجع الدالة GETPIVOTDATA بيانات مرئية من PivotTable.
في هذا المثال، ترجع =GETPIVOTDATA("Sales",A3) إجمالي مبلغ المبيعات من PivotTable:
بناء الجملة
GETPIVOTDATA(data_field, pivot_table, [field1, item1, field2, item2], ...)
يحتوي بناء جملة الدالة GETPIVOTDATA على الوسيطات التالية:
الوسيطة |
الوصف |
---|---|
data_field مطلوبة |
اسم حقل PivotTable الذي يحتوي على البيانات التي تريد استردادها. يجب أن يكون هذا في علامات اقتباس. |
pivot_table مطلوبة |
مرجع إلى أي خلية أو نطاق من الخلايا أو نطاق مسمى من الخلايا في PivotTable. يتم استخدام هذه المعلومات لتحديد أي PivotTable يحتوي على البيانات التي تريد استردادها. |
field1, item1, field2, item2... اختياري |
أزواج أسماء الحقول وأسماء العناصر من 1 حتى 126 التي تصف البيانات التي تريد استردادها. يمكن وضع الأزواج بأي ترتيب. يجب تضمين أسماء الحقول وأسماء العناصر بخلاف التواريخ والأرقام بين علامات اقتباس. بالنسبة ل OLAP PivotTables، يمكن أن تحتوي العناصر على الاسم المصدر للبعد وكذلك اسم مصدر العنصر. قد يظهر زوج حقل وعنصر PivotTable لـ OLAP، كما يلي: "[المنتج]"،"[المنتج].[كافة المنتجات].[الأطعمة].[المنتجات المخبوزة]" |
ملاحظات:
-
يمكنك بسرعة إدخال صيغة GETPIVOTDATA بسيطة عن طريق كتابة = (علامة التساوي) في الخلية التي تريد إرجاع القيمة إليها ثم النقر فوق الخلية في PivotTable التي تحتوي على البيانات التي تريد إرجاعها.
-
يمكنك إيقاف تشغيل هذه الميزة عن طريق تحديد أي خلية داخل PivotTable موجود، ثم الانتقال إلى علامة التبويب تحليل PivotTable > PivotTable > خيارات > إلغاء تحديد الخيار إنشاء GetPivotData .
-
يمكن تضمين الحقول أو العناصر المحسوبة والحسابات المخصصة في حسابات GETPIVOTDATA.
-
إذا كانت الوسيطة pivot_table عبارة عن نطاق يتضمن اثنين أو أكثر من جداول PivotTable، فسيتم استرداد البيانات من أي PivotTable تم إنشاؤه مؤخرا.
-
إذا كانت وسيطات الحقل والعنصر تصف خلية واحدة، فسيتم إرجاع قيمة تلك الخلية بغض النظر عما إذا كانت سلسلة أو رقما أو خطأ أو خلية فارغة.
-
إذا احتوى أحد العناصر على تاريخ، فيجب أن يتم التعبير عن قيمته كرقم تسلسلي أو تعبئته باستخدام الدالة DATE، بحيث يتم الاحتفاظ بالقيمة إذا تم فتح ورقة العمل في إعدادات محلية مختلفة. على سبيل المثال، يمكن إدخال العنصر الذي يشير إلى التاريخ 5 مارس، 1999 على الشكل 36224 أو DATE(1999,3,5). من الممكن إدخال الأوقات كقيم عشرية أو باستخدام الدالة TIME.
-
إذا لم تكن الوسيطة pivot_table نطاقا يتم فيه العثور على PivotTable، فترجع الدالة GETPIVOTDATA #REF!.
-
إذا لم تصف الوسيطات حقلاً مرئياً، أو إذا تضمنت عامل تصفية لتقرير لا يتم عرض البيانات المصفاة فيه، فتعمل GETPIVOTDATA على إرجاع #REF!. وهي قيمة خطأ.
أمثلة
تعرض الصيغ الموجودة في المثال أدناه أساليب مختلفة للحصول على البيانات من PivotTable.
هل تحتاج إلى مزيد من المساعدة؟
يمكنك دائماً الاستفسار من أحد الخبراء في مجتمع Excel التقني أو الحصول على الدعم في المجتمعات.
اطلع أيضاً على